#6e3f5f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6e3f5f is composed of 43.1% red, 24.7% green and 37.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 42.7% magenta, 13.6% yellow and 56.9% black. It has a hue angle of 319.1 degrees, a saturation of 27.2% and a lightness of 33.9%. #6e3f5f color hex could be obtained by blending #dc7ebe with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#6e3f5f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0609 is the darkest color, while #fefd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#6e3f5f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5a5358 is the less saturated color, while #aa0375 is the most saturated one.
